Naiu Airport serves the remote Naiu Atoll in French Polynesia, providing essential air access to one of the Tuamotu Archipelago's lesser-visited atolls. As a small regional facility, it primarily handles inter-island flights and supports the local community's transportation needs. The airport plays a vital role in connecting this isolated Pacific atoll with the rest of French Polynesia.

🚖 Getting There

Getting to Naiu Airport typically requires a connecting flight from Tahiti-Faa'a International Airport (PPT) via Air Tahiti's inter-island network. Ground transportation on the atoll is limited, so arranging pickup with a local contact or accommodation provider in advance is advisable. There are no public bus services; bicycles and local vehicles are common ways to reach the airport terminal.
